Please note that we do not RATIFY contracts — this is the responsibility of the licensed REALTOR®.  RATM TCs will always do a thorough review of your contract upon receipt and let you know of any missing information, signatures, initials, or documents.

Our Transaction Coordinators are not a party to the transaction and do not intend to “replace” the role of the agent or take on any liability. Agents will retain all responsibility for the contract and will take part fully in all negotiations — our role is to assist administratively to ensure contract tasks are performed and to monitor the deadlines to get you and your clients to the closing table.

Here is what your Transaction Coordinator will do to assist you and your clients:

Review the contract for completion/accuracy and alert the agent of anything that is missing

Send a copy of the ratified contract and all addenda to the Title Company, Lender, Cooperating Agent, your client, delivery addresses

Assist with scheduling Home, Radon, Well, Septic, Termite, and any other negotiated inspections at the request of the agent

Confirm delivery of the EMD and be sure all parties receive a copy of the check or wire receipt

Order the Home Warranty

Order and deliver HOA and Condo Documents

Schedule the Walk Through

Schedule Settlement

Stay in contact with the Title Company to ensure they have all of the documentation needed to prepare the Settlement Statement

Obtain a copy of the ALTA/CD from the Title Company for the agent to review and approve

Stay in contact with the Lender to ensure the appraisal is ordered, in/through underwriting, and that the loan is staying on track per the contract deadlines

Track all contingency deadlines and remind parties, as necessary

We will prepare addenda as long as the agent provides the exact wording that is to be used

Obtain signatures and initials on necessary documents as approved by agent

Deliver addenda to necessary parties (title, lender, other agent, delivery addresses, etc)

Obtain Utility Information and send this information to buyers and/or remind sellers to transfer utilities out of their names when appropriate (after settlement or after a rent back)

Confirm that the CD is sent to and acknowledged by the buyers at least 3 days before settlement

Send all contract documents along with the executed Settlement Statement to your brokerage after settlement

Agent Responsibilities

  • Fully ratify the contract and complete all negotiations on behalf of your clients
  • Submit your ratified contract through www.RealAdvantageTM.com
  • Change the status in the MLS
  • Advise your client throughout the transaction
  • Prepare addenda or provide exact wording in writing for TC to write addenda for you
  • Lockbox and sign removal (unless RATM is assisting with your Listing Coordination — we will then order the sign installation and removal)
